What is the Cost to Diagnose the Code?
Labor: 1.0
The cost to diagnose the B1633 code is 1.0 hour of labor. The diagnosis time and labor rates at auto repair shops vary depending on the location, make and model of the vehicle, and even the engine type. Most auto repair shops charge between $75 and $150 per hour.

What Does the B1633 Code Mean?
The Side Collision Sensor Right (RH) circuit (to determine deployment of the Curtain Shield Airbag Assembly RH) is composed of the Center Airbag Sensor Assembly, Side Airbag Sensor RH, and Rear Airbag Sensor RH. The Rear Airbag Sensor RH detects impacts to the vehicle and sends signals to the Center Airbag Sensor Assembly to determine if the airbag should be deployed. The Diagnostic Trouble Code (DTC) is stored when a malfunction is detected for the rear side collision RH circuit (to determine deployment of the Curtain Shield Airbag Assembly RH).

Precautions for SRS “AIR BAG” and “SEAT BELT PRE-TENSIONER” Service
Never probe the electrical connectors on air bag, side air curtain modules or seat belts.
Never disassemble or tamper with safety belt buckle/retractor pretensioners, adaptive load limiting retractors, safety belt inflators, or probe the electrical connectors.
Do not use electrical test equipment to check SRS circuits unless instructed to in this Service Manual.
Before servicing the SRS, turn ignition switch OFF, disconnect both battery cables and wait at least 3 minutes. For approximately 3 minutes after the cables are removed,
it is still possible for the air bag and seat belt pre-tensioner to deploy. Therefore, do not work on any SRS connectors or wires until at least 3 minutes have passed.
Failure to follow this instruction may result in the accidental deployment of these modules, which increases the risk of serious personal injury or death.
